A virus scan is one of the very most important maintenance and protection methods for just about any system attached to the net or handling digital files. The primary purpose of a virus scan would be to find, recognize, and remove malicious software, typically called malware, that could damage some type of computer system, bargain data, or let unauthorized access to sensitive information. The word "virus" is often applied commonly by daily people, though it technically describes a certain type of malware. Contemporary antivirus computer software was created to handle a wide selection of electronic threats, including worms, Trojans, ransomware, adware, spyware, rootkits, and other destructive entities. With cyber threats growing significantly innovative, virus checking has changed in to a complicated, multi-layered protection mechanism for private products, enterprise techniques, and cloud-based infrastructures.

A virus scan typically runs by comparing files, programs, and the system's memory against a repository of identified malware signatures. These signatures are unique strings of code or conduct styles that safety scientists have determined in formerly discovered viruses. Each time a match is located, the antivirus computer software both quarantines, deletes, or fixes the infected file with regards to the intensity of the danger and the software settings. In addition to signature-based detection, modern antivirus programs use heuristic evaluation to discover unknown or zero-day threats by observing dubious conduct and signal defects within files or operating processes. This is very important in an electronic landscape where new spyware variants arise daily, often concealed to evade conventional recognition methods.

There are typically two principal types of disease tests available on most antivirus programs: quick tests and complete scans. A fast check centers on the most weak regions of a system where malware is most likely to full cover up, such as for example system files, working operations, and common directories. This is ideal for regular, routine checks and can generally be finished inside a several minutes. In contrast, the full scan is a thorough examination of all files, applications, pushes, and related products on a system. While more time-consuming virus scan often taking a long time with regards to the storage size and performance of the device — the full check is important for uncovering deeply stuck malware or threats lurking in less obvious elements of the system.

Scheduled virus scans are yet another useful function supplied by antivirus solutions. By setting runs to run automatically at predetermined times, customers may assure regular preservation without handbook intervention. This is particularly important in enterprise situations where consistent, organization-wide scanning policies support maintain cybersecurity hygiene. Regular disease runs not just find and eliminate current spyware but may also recognize protection vulnerabilities, such as for instance obsolete software, poor passwords, or potentially unrequired applications (PUAs) that would be exploited by internet attackers.
